Turkmenistani Manat
The Turkmenistani Manat (TMT) is the official currency of Turkmenistan, used for all monetary transactions within the country.
History/Origin
The Turkmenistani Manat was introduced in 1993, replacing the Soviet ruble, and has undergone several redenominations to stabilize the economy and control inflation.
Current Use
Today, the Manat is widely used in Turkmenistan for everyday transactions, banking, and trade, with banknotes and coins issued by the Central Bank of Turkmenistan.
Croatian Kuna
The Croatian Kuna (HRK) is the official currency of Croatia, used for everyday transactions and monetary exchanges within the country.
History/Origin
The Kuna was introduced in 1994, replacing the Croatian dinar, following Croatia's independence. It was initially pegged to the German Mark and later to the Euro, with a managed float system.
Current Use
The Kuna remains the official currency of Croatia, widely used across the country for all forms of payment. Croatia adopted the Euro in 2023, but the Kuna continues to be used alongside it during the transition period.
